The player swap involving Ravindra Jadeja and Sanju Samson between Chennai Super Kings (CSK) and Rajasthan Royals (RR) was officially confirmed by the Indian Premier League (IPL) on Saturday (November 15, 2025) morning.

As part of the multi-player trade, Jadeja and England allrounder Sam Curran will turn out in Royals’ pink for the 2026 season, while Samson has emerged as the marquee acquisition for CSK as it looks to reconfigure its squad ahead of the next cycle.

The Hindu had reported earlier this week that the Jadeja–Samson trade was virtually sealed. The formal announcement came hours before the deadline for submitting retentions ahead of next month’s auction.

Samson — who has been a Royals mainstay since his debut in 2013 barring the two seasons when the franchise was suspended — had conveyed his desire to move on during pre-season discussions. Despite interest from three other teams, RR eventually accepted CSK’s offer involving Samson and Jadeja.

For Jadeja, who was one of the Royals’ breakout performers in the inaugural IPL seasons but has since become synonymous with CSK’s yellow, the shift will mark a striking change in colours. According to the IPL statement, Jadeja has taken a pay cut from ₹18 crore to ₹14 crore. It is understood that the Royals are also considering him as a potential captaincy option.

RR had initially sought Dewald Brevis along with Jadeja in exchange for Samson, but eventually settled on Curran’s all-ound package as part of the final arrangement.

Meanwhile, the IPL also confirmed two other significant moves: Mohammed Shami’s transfer from Sunrisers Hyderabad to Lucknow Super Giants, and Arjun Tendulkar being acquired by LSG from Mumbai Indians.

The full list of retained players ahead of the December 16 auction in Abu Dhabi will be announced at 5 p.m. on Saturday (November 15, 2025).

Trading Jadeja toughest decision for CSK, says Viswanathan

Commenting on the trade, Chennai Super Kings Managing Director, K.S. Viswanathan, said, “A transition in a team’s journey is never easy. Trading out a player like Ravindra Jadeja, who has been an integral part of the franchise for more than a decade, and Sam Curran was one of the toughest decisions we have taken in the team’s history.”

“The decision was taken with mutual understanding with both Jadeja and Curran. We are deeply grateful for Jadeja’s extraordinary contributions and the legacy he leaves behind. We wish both Jadeja and Curran the best for the future.

“We also welcome Sanju Samson, whose skill set and achievements complement our ambitions. This decision has been made with great thought, respect, and a long-term vision,” he added.
